Biking in Trysil

In Trysil, there’s biking for all levels – from adrenaline-filled challenges to relaxing rides. Here, children can try balance bikes for the first time, families explore family-friendly trails, and visitors of all ages can stay active among miles of bike trails. To ride in Trysil Bike Arena, you’ll need TrysilPasset.

Trysil Bike Park: Lift-assisted mountain biking with flow, bermed turns and challenges for riders with some experience.

Trysil Trail Park: Trail riding with everything from easy, family-friendly flow trails to technical sections.

Trysil Skill Park: Pumptracks and skills areas that are perfect for practising balance, technique and control.

  • B-RAGE in Trysil

    B-RAGE is a double black trail in Gullia. It is 600 metres long and has no less than 20 big jumps, drops and awesome wooden elements.

  • Cycle workshop and bike hotel

    Shimano Service Center at the Tourist Centre in Trysil offers everything from simple repairs to full service of all types of bikes – including electric bikes. You can also store your bike in the service centre's new cycle hotel. With storage, the service comes to ensure that the bike is ready for the next season.
